Transaction 8ff33aad5a84b8cf1937a7025d95b79ce9060c302a626041ec96321a9dfd1857
1 Input
2 Outputs
- 8ff33aad5a84b8cf1937a7025d95b79ce9060c302a626041ec96321a9dfd1857:0
- 8ff33aad5a84b8cf1937a7025d95b79ce9060c302a626041ec96321a9dfd1857:1
value 76827
address 15Y1c2xCyfin3xfuoMFRUmXA7vLYvSbJBZ
value 50000000
address 38PZX5oeDu38uFB8p2c8YMoRjZArodKCp6